Image Credit Yams are a Safe Treat for Your Dog Yams are a rich source of essential nutrients like fiber, potassium, copper, and vitamins A and C. WebFeeding large amounts of sweet potato or other red/orange coloured vegetables can give your dog’s poop an orange tinge. This is not something to worry about. If you dog does not eat these types of food then the yellow or orange hue may indicate the development of liver or biliary problems, so visit your vet. list of people on wheaties box https://larryrtaylor.com

WebMar 3, 2024 · Yes, they can! So long as they’re served up plain — sorry, pups, no sweet potato fries for you! — your dog can enjoy this starchy, yet sweet vegetable cooked, boiled, steamed, baked or even dehydrated. And the best part is that sweet potatoes are available at most grocery stores year-round, inexpensive, and easy to prepare.
